Phone number ☎️ 02002003378 👆 is reported as a scam call pretending to be from HMRC, using threats about warrants and arrest to scare people into pressing numbers. Many have said they just hang up straight away as it’s clearly fake. The callers sound pushy and try to cause panic but no real HMRC behaviour involves this type of call. Users frequently warn others to be cautious and not engage. Overall, it’s a common phone scam aiming to trick or intimidate recipients.

About 02 Numbers
These numbers correspond to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by domestic and commercial premises. Sometimes referred to as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are based on the time of day. Most service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are based on the chosen calling plan, with many pl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
